Chapter 6 - Footsteps in the HallLily stood in the doorway. She wasn't in her pajamas this time; she wore a bright yellow dress with little sunflowers, clutching her one-eared rabbit under one arm. Behind her, Sophia stood paralyzed, terrified, whispering frantic apologies.

"Mr. Moretti," Lily announced clearly, ignoring the assembly of terrifying men in expensive suits. "Leo the lion needs a bedtime story tonight. The elephant is lonely."
A nervous chuckle escaped from one of the councilmen, quickly swallowed by a cough under Dominic’s searing glare.
Dominic didn't yell. He didn't order Sophia to drag her away. Instead, a remarkably tender expression softened the harsh lines of his face. He stood up from his chair, pushing it back with a gentle scrape against the hardwood.
"Excuse me, gentlemen," Dominic said quietly to the frozen table. "It's time for my story."

He walked past the stunned crowd, knelt down on one knee in front of the three-year-old, and offered her his hand. Without a shred of hesitation, Lily placed her tiny hand inside his massive palm.
As Dominic walked her back toward the private stairwell, carrying her up to the quiet sanctuary of the upper floors, Alessandro watched with murder in his eyes. The syndicate was slipping through his fingers. If Dominic was no longer broken, Alessandro had only one option left.
